can someone help me with these questions? Meter – Meter signatures are often called “time signatures.”
The contestant should be able to look at a meter signature and tell the following things:
1. Whether it is duple, triple, quadruple, or quintuple meter.
2. Whether it involves a simple or compound beat.
3. The time value of any note or rest in that meter.
For contest purposes, 6/8 is duple compound meter, with two counts to themeasure.
The student should be able to see rhythmic notation and determine what meter signatureit suggests.
